Claims
- 1. A method of providing a mixture of substances at a well site, comprising the steps of:
- transporting to the well site on a single vehicle a plurality of containers each containing a respective liquid additive and each including an additive outlet, a plurality of liquid additive metering means for providing a metered flow of a liquid additive each including a metering inlet and a metering outlet, and mixer means for mixing a metered liquid additive and a base liquid, which mixer means includes a plurality of additive inlets;
- manually connecting, at the well site, with a first hose the additive outlet of a selected one of the containers and the metering inlet of a selected one of the liquid additive metering means;
- manually connecting, at the well site, with a second hose the metering outlet of the selected metering means and a selected one of the additive inlets of the mixing means; and
- controlling, at the well site, the selected metering means to provide a metered flow of the liquid additive of the selected one of the containers so that provided in the mixing means is a mixture having a desired concentration of the liquid additive of the selected one of the containers.
- 2. A method as defined in claim 1, further comprising the steps of:
- setting the size of an opening defined above a tub of the mixing means, including:
- entering a desired dry additive concentration factor into a computer carried on the single vehicle;
- determining in the computer a flow rate of the mixture;
- calculating in the computer, in response to the desired dry additive concentration factor and the flow rate of the mixture, a desired flow rate of dry additive to obtain the dry additive concentration indicated by the desired dry additive concentration factor;
- displaying indicia representing the calculated desired flow rate of dry additive; and
- manually adjusting, in response to the displayed indicia, a movable gate disposed above the tub of the mixing means so that the size of the opening defined above the tub is thereby set; and
- pouring dry additive through the opening and into the tub so that the mixing means mixes a controlled amount of dry additive into the mixture.
- 3. A method as defined in claim 2, wherein said step of controlling the selected metering means includes:
- entering a dry additive coefficient into the computer;
- calculating a clean flow rate, including multiplying the dry additive coefficient and the desired dry additive concentration factor to define a product, adding the product to one to define a sum and dividing the sum into the determined flow rate of the mixture;
- determining the flow rate of the metered liquid additive of the selected one of the containers;
- calculating, in response to the clean flow rate and the flow rate of the metered liquid additive, the concentration of the metered liquid additive in the mixture;
- displaying the calculated concentration of the metered liquid additive; and
- manually adjusting the operation of the selected metering means until the displayed calculated concentration of the metered liquid additive equals a desired concentration thereof.
- 4. A method as defined in claim 1, wherein:
- said method further comprises adding dry additive to the mixture in a desired concentration; and
- said step of controlling the selected metering means includes:
- entering a desired dry additive concentration factor and a dry additive coefficient into a digital computer carried on the single vehicle;
- determining in the computer a flow rate of the mixture which includes the base liquid, the metered liquid additive and the dry additive;
- calculating a clean flow rate in response to the equation CFR=DFR/(1+XY),
- where
- CFR=clean flow rate, DFR=the determined flow rate of the mixture,
- X=the entered dry additive coefficient, and
- Y=the entered desired dry additive concentration factor;
- determining the flow rate of the metered liquid additive of the selected one of the containers;
- calculating, in response to the clean flow rate and the flow rate of the metered liquid additive, the concentration of the metered liquid additive in the mixture;
- displaying the calculated concentration of the metered liquid additive; and
- manually adjusting the operation of the selected metering means until the displayed calculated concentration of the metered liquid additive equals a desired concentration thereof.
